When visiting Dubai, one must to respect local traditions. The city values its heritage, and overlooking these can lead to offense. For instance, physical intimacy in public are frowned upon, although they seem normal in other cultures. Similarly, loud or disruptive behavior in communal areas is considered deeply disrespectful, especially near religious sites. Travelers ought to be aware that speaking negatively about leadership cultural practices might provoke severe penalties.
An additional vital consideration concerns rules around taking photos. Capturing footage of official structures, transport hubs, or specific zones absent prior approval is prohibited. Even, filming residents, particularly ladies, without their approval may be seen as disrespectful, resulting in fines. Make sure to ask first as well as avoid directing lenses where prohibited.
Dress Code Violations to Avoid
The city’s clothing norms is often a frequent mistake among visitors. Although Dubai embraces cosmopolitanism compared to neighboring regions, conservative dressing is very much expected in communal areas. Short or tight garments including mini-dresses, sleeveless tops, or excessive cleavage may attract disapproving glances, especially in souks, public offices, or religious sites.
Beachwear should stay confined to resort areas or allocated spots. Wearing bikinis or speedos at non-private shores is often permitted, but cover-ups are expected when leaving the beachfront. In the same way, men ought to steer clear of going shirtless inside retail complexes or restaurants. Respecting these norms doesn’t just prevents confrontation but also signals respect for traditions.
Handling Public Behavior and Etiquette
Civil conduct within the emirate is governed by a mix of Islamic principles and modern ordinances. Actions deemed disrespectful in Western cultures can be significantly graver here. For instance, uttering curses openly, gesticulating offensively, or public confrontations might prompt authorities stepping in.
An additional layer relates to Ramadan, where consuming food, drinking, or using tobacco outdoors is prohibited even for tourists. Those who disregard this risk fines, therefore, prudent to dine discreetly at this time. Similarly, playing loud music in neighborhoods or causing a nuisance after hours may lead to fines.
Navigating Alcohol Consumption Laws
Though the emirate permits the sale of alcoholic beverages, rigorous laws govern its use. Travelers need to note that drinking in open areas is prohibited and could result in arrests. Alcohol may only be consumed within designated zones such as hotels or exclusive lounges.
Bringing in spirits into Dubai absent authorization is also not allowed, and going over personal import quotas could lead to seizure. Furthermore, drinking and driving involves heavy fines, including imprisonment, even for those without prior convictions. To avoid issues, use taxi services as well as drink judiciously.

Respecting Religious Practices and Sites
The emirate boasts several religious landmarks, each demanding decorum from visitors. Non-Muslims are typically restricted accessing places of worship during services, though a few prominent buildings like the renowned Jumeirah Mosque host guided tours to promote understanding. When participating, appropriate attire is required, and guests should slip off footwear before entering.
Capturing images at religious sites is often prohibited, save for direct authorization is granted. Moreover, ridiculing prayer customs, such as the call to prayer, prostration, or religious fasting is viewed as highly disrespectful. Even, disturbing a worshipper as well as stepping on sajjada can provoke sanctions. Consistently observe signage and show respectful awareness.
Avoiding Illegal Substances and Medications
Dubai’s policies regarding illegal substances is one of the most rigorous globally. Carrying of even trace amounts of banned substances may trigger automatic imprisonment. This applies to marijuana, cannabidiol goods, and specific pharmaceuticals deemed restricted. Visitors should confirm the legality of their medicines ahead of their trip through the UAE’s health ministry.
Moreover, bringing in items with restricted botanicals or opioid-based medications without a prescription remains banned. Customs officials frequently check baggage and may detain travelers in possession of prohibited goods. To prevent legal nightmares, leave behind potentially problematic products ahead of entering or keep a doctor’s note for required drugs.

Legal Consequences of Ignoring Local Laws
Overlooking the city’s statutes may escalate to severe outcomes, regardless of awareness. Seemingly small violations including uttering expletives, discarding trash improperly, or consuming food outdoors while fasting may seem trivial, but they can result in substantial penalties. More serious breaches, including drug possession, insulting authorities, or financial scams, can result in prolonged detention, deportation, or permanent entry restrictions.
Judicial processes across the UAE can be rapid, with limited chances of recourse. Visitors arrested under these circumstances rarely receive leniency, regardless of whether the violation was unintentional. Therefore, understanding local laws as well as practicing vigilance is non-negotiable to ensure smooth travels.
